Riot Games Comes Out Against SOPA and PIPA

January 11, 2012 by Josh Harmon

The League of Legends developer has become the largest gaming company to publicaly oppose the bills.

League of Legends developer Riot Games has posted a statment on their official forums decrying SOPA and PIPA, the controversial anti-piracy bills currently under consideration by the US Congress.

"We’re not usually inclined to comment on politics," the statement begins. "We’re a game company, and making games is just a whole lot more fun. But there is legislation under consideration today by the United States Congress that gives us serious concern."

The post then goes onto explain the various ways the bill would harm League of Legends players, from killing the livestreaming community to threatening the continued existence of their forums and in-game chat. In addition, Riot says the propsed bills "raise serious constitutional free speech issues, and could even compromise the basic security infrastructure of the internet."

To help explain their position, Riot's corporate attorney is currently participating in a question and answer session on Reddit's popular IAmA section.
